Use with Caution in These Scenarios
While the Coffee Valentine Day Watercolor PNG SVG is incredibly versatile, there are situations where it might not perform optimally. If your brand has an overly minimal identity, this asset could introduce unnecessary visual noise. Similarly, in formal corporate branding or dense information layouts, it may dilute the message rather than enhance it.
Also, keep in mind that the watercolor texture isn’t always legible in small mobile graphics. Always preview it at various sizes before using it in digital ads or social media thumbnails. And when placed on low-contrast backgrounds, the illustration might lose its impact, so ensure there's enough tonal variation to maintain clarity.
Brand Designer Notes for Optimal Use
- Test with your brand color palette: See how the warm tones of the watercolor interact with your primary and secondary colors.
- Check black and white usage: Confirm that the design still holds its shape and meaning in grayscale for print or accessibility purposes.
- Place inside real campaign mockups: Use tools like Adobe Illustrator or Photoshop to see how it looks alongside actual copy and photography.
- Preview on mobile screens: Ensure it doesn't pixelate or become too busy when viewed on smaller devices.
- Test readability in small sizes: Especially important for digital ads or social media stories where detail matters less than clarity.
- Compare against competitor visuals: Does it stand out? Does it reflect your unique value proposition better than what others are using?
- Font pairing experiments: Try it with serif fonts for elegance, sans-serif for modernity, script for romance, or display fonts for bold statements.
- Review spacing and balance: Don’t let the asset dominate the layout. Keep the design breathable and focused on the main message.
- Confirm commercial licensing: Before using it in paid campaigns, client work, or branded materials, ensure it comes with a valid commercial license.
